Ekonomické aspekty využívání dendromasy pro energetické účely

The focus of this work is on the economic aspects of using dendromass (logging residues) for energy purposes in the production of energy chips. In defining economic factors, the paper employs as a basis actual manufacturing and sales data from 247 business cases in 2011-2012 at nine forest properties. The data reflect 44,971 m3 of harvested wood, 6671 tons of energy chips with a total energy content of 63.92 TJ. The initial objective of the paper is to derive average and proportional variables using data from actual business cases and then use these to discover the limiting production values, particularly those of the purchase price and energy chips, as well as logging residues and the limiting transport distance. The relationships derived are shown both mathematically and graphically. Results found in the paper are primarily designated for preproduction calculation by economic entities, the valuation of logging residues and as a basis for national policy regarding both forests and energy.
